    Next 6 Months: A Flood of Electric SUVs to Hit Indian Market

    The Indian automotive landscape is about to undergo a significant transformation with a wave of new electric SUVs scheduled for launch in the next six months. Major players like Mahindra, Maruti Suzuki, and VinFast are responding to the increasing demand for electric vehicles by introducing new models, many timed to coincide with the festive season.

    **VinFast’s India Push: VF 6 and VF 7**

    VinFast is preparing to launch the VF 6 and VF 7 electric SUVs in India. The company is assembling these models at its Tamil Nadu plant using the CKD (Completely Knocked Down) method. The VF 6 and VF 7 are anticipated to offer a driving range exceeding 480 kilometers on a single charge. The company is already accepting pre-orders for both of these feature-rich SUVs.

    **Maruti Suzuki Joins the EV Race: e Vitara**

    Maruti Suzuki is gearing up to introduce the e Vitara. Production for both domestic and international markets will be handled at the Gujarat plant. The launch is anticipated in early 2026. This mid-size electric SUV will be offered in Delta, Zeta, and Alpha variants. It is likely to be available with 61.1 kWh and 48.8 kWh battery options, offering a range exceeding 500 kilometers on a single charge.

    **Mahindra’s Electric Offensive: XEV 7e and XUV 3XO EV**

    Mahindra is expanding its electric vehicle lineup with the XEV 7e, a three-row electric SUV based on the XUV.e8 concept. The XEV 7e is expected to boast features like a triple-screen setup, a panoramic sunroof, and ADAS technology, similar to the XUV700. Additionally, Mahindra is testing the XUV 3XO EV, which is planned to be positioned below the XUV400. Both the XEV 7e and XUV 3XO EV are slated for launch in the first half of 2026.
